Unlike conventional staplers designed for light office use, heavy duty staplers are engineered to handle thicker paper stacks with greater force and stability. Their reinforced construction enables users to bind large documents quickly without damaging pages or causing staple deformation. Whether used in government agencies, universities, printing companies, logistics centers, banks, or corporate offices, heavy duty staplers provide dependable performance for continuous daily workloads.
Modern Heavy Duty Staplers are manufactured using high-strength metal frames combined with precision mechanical components. This construction improves durability while maintaining consistent stapling pressure during repeated use. The robust internal mechanism delivers powerful penetration through thick paper stacks, reducing incomplete stapling and minimizing document damage. Compared with ordinary staplers, heavy duty models significantly reduce the likelihood of staple bending and paper jams.

Another important benefit is user comfort. Continuous stapling can create hand fatigue, particularly when large numbers of documents require processing every day. Modern heavy duty staplers feature ergonomic handles that maximize leverage while reducing the amount of force required during operation. Stable anti-slip bases improve positioning accuracy and provide additional safety for operators, making repetitive document binding more comfortable and efficient.
